Understanding Water Softening: How It Works
The system works by replacing calcium and magnesium ions with sodium or potassium ions. This exchange process reduces water hardness, leading to several benefits:
- Prevents scale buildup in pipes, water heaters, and appliances
- Improves soap and detergent performance
- Creates softer water for skin and hair
- Reduces household maintenance needs
- Enhances overall household comfort

Signs the Current Setup is Failing
In Durango, homeowners may notice several signs indicating that their current water treatment system is not effectively addressing hard water issues. One of the most common symptoms is the presence of scale buildup on faucets, showerheads, and appliances. This accumulation can manifest as white, chalky deposits, which not only detracts from the appearance of your fixtures but can also lead to decreased efficiency and potential damage over time.
Another observable symptom is the reduced effectiveness of soaps and detergents. If you find yourself using more soap than usual to achieve lather or noticing that your laundry comes out less clean, it could be a sign that hard water is interfering with the cleaning process. Additionally, homeowners may experience dry skin or hair after bathing, as minerals in hard water can strip moisture away.
